Transaction e59e68fdc0d23a7701af083b282d9401e06c96dedbf28d0080097ec6019e688d
1 Input
1 Output
-
e59e68fdc0d23a7701af083b282d9401e06c96dedbf28d0080097ec6019e688d:0
- value
- 1294896
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df075e75a9b0c01798048c56a00465f47a5cac95 OP_EQUAL
- address
- 3N2HSKy87sjEx9tc12621Wcqh7n5RAyZmm